
Inhibitors
Inhibitors are molecules that bind to enzymes, receptors, or other proteins to reduce or block their biological activity. These compounds are widely used in research to study biological pathways, understand disease mechanisms, and develop therapeutic drugs. Inhibitors play a crucial role in the treatment of various diseases, including cancer, cardiovascular diseases, and infections.
